Interrogative sentences or questions that begin with wh-words: what, when, where, who, whom, which, whose, why, and how are called wh-questions. WebEssentially, there are two types of questions: Yes / No questions and Wh– questions. Wh– questions are so called because with the exception of the question word how, all the question words begin with the letters Wh.They are also called open questions because the number of possible responses is limitless. Dispositions describe being ready and willing to learn. For example, there is a big diference between being able to read and being disposed to read (being ready and willing and having the disposition to be a reader). The toads were first released in Queensland, but they have now spread as far as northern Western Australia.
